How to examine Koba-Nielsen-Olesen scaling for hadron-nucleus collisions

We present a method to examine Koba-Nielsen-Olesen (KNO) scaling for hadron-nucleus collisions in connection with measurements of the average charged multiplicity and inelastic total cross sections. It is shown that the assumption of a universal KNO scaling curve for the multiplicity distributions turns out to be inconsistent with experimental evidence concerning A dependence of the absorption cross section and the nuclear multiplicity ratio.
